Certainty (From, Illuminating Night)



Oh summer birds are going now
With longings and dreams,
From autumn forest lowbrow
Withering moments beseems.

My words, what's it I write?
In vanishing thoughts and lamping;
Whiles of summer's last flight,
Preparing new winter’s encamping.
